ENGLISH
Location of the Buttons
Control panel (Standby/On/Attenuator) button Turns on and off the power, and also attenuates the sounds. (angle) button Adjust the control panel angle. 0 (eject) button Open the control panel (and eject the disc if any).
Remote sensor*
VOLUME+/� button Adjust the volume level.
MENU button Show the Main Menu. Reset button Reset the built-in microcomputer.
Touch Panel Used to operate the receiver. (control panel release) button Detach the control panel.
* DO NOT expose the remote sensor on the control panel to strong light (direct sunlight or artificial lighting).
DISP (display) button Change the information shown on the display.
WARNINGS on the battery: � Store the battery in a place where children cannot reach. If a child accidentally swallows the battery, consult a doctor immediately. � Do not recharge, short, disassemble, or heat the battery or dispose of it in a fire. Doing any of these things may cause the battery to give off heat, crack, or start a fire.
� Do not leave the battery with other metallic materials. Doing this may cause the battery to give off heat, crack, or start a fire. � When throwing away or saving the battery, wrap it in tape and insulate; otherwise, the battery may start to give off heat, crack, or start a fire. � Do not poke the battery with tweezers or similar tools. Doing this may cause the battery to give off heat, crack, or start a fire.
